A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

© 梁志斌 中级黑马   /  2016-1-20 15:08  /  435 人查看  /  3 人回复  /   0 人收藏 转载请遵从CC协议 禁止商业使用本文

什么时候方法可以被重写?
或者什么时候不能被重写?

3 个回复

倒序浏览
当函数内部逻辑需要更改的时候
   依照教程上可能就是,需要实现接口和抽象方法的时候
回复 使用道具 举报
当一个类继承了另一个类,就必须重写另一个类的抽象方法
也就是说父类中被abstract修饰的必须重写
没有被修饰的,可重写可不重写,不重写就相当于调用了父类的这个方法,重写后就用子类特有的。
父类被final修饰的方法不可以被重写
回复 使用道具 举报
private、final、static修饰的不能被重写吧。
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马